
Leicester City manager Brendan Rodgers has told his players that they can reach Europe through the league this season.
The Foxes are firmly mid-table at present, but do have games in hand on the teams above them.
After defeating Crystal Palace 2-1 on Sunday to move into ninth place, Rodgers wants his players to go all the way to the end of the campaign.
Asked about Europe post-game, he said: "I've just said that we can't stop until the last whistle goes.
"This has been really unfortunate and a real challenge for us this season without our top players, but now they're coming back, and because they are back, it means I can rest some, and then I can put in a fresh team. We made seven changes, but the players were all contributing and performing.
"It's going to be a big challenge for us because we're playing right the way through until the end of the season, but we're going to fight to the very end, and let's see where it takes us. It's a great three points today, a really good performance, and now we'll get the plan ready for Thursday, and just keep going."
